Pours a dark ruby, almost mahogany, with tiny bits of yeast in stasis throughout the liquid. Aroma is vinous, alcoholic, malty-rich and sweet with a touch of clover and tobacco leaf. Flavor is intense rich malt with a slightly dry bite (though still plenty sweet) with leafy, medium-bitter hops, dash of raisin, a bit of nutty yeast and smooth toasty alcohol that almost gets a little boozy. Monster-thick palate coats every corner of the mouth and becomes a touch cloying. American barleywines seem to fall into two camps: sweet and leafy/grassy/lightly fruity (epitomized by DFH’s Olde School) or leafy/grassy, dry, and hopped up the yingwoo (epitomized by seemingly every version made by the higer-volume West Coast breweries). I hate the latter, adore the former, and this is one I adore. I look forward to opening my other bottle of this gem in 2008. alexanderj (2287), Chino Hills, California, USA
